Senate Intelligence Committee Staff Director Michael Casey has been nominated by President Joe Biden to lead the National Counterintelligence and Security Center, replacing Acting Chief Michael Orlando, who fulfilled the position for almost two and a half years before going into retirement last month, according to The Record, a news site by cybersecurity firm Recorded Future.
